Theres just too much clunky stuff. Provision i cant see most of the time being worth the slot, and open dossier is funny for casual ( i did dirty contract open dossier once for fun) but bad most of the time. Streamline the deck and use contracts to remove key minions and a famed vamp, not to be able to play dossier. Adding the khabar that gains 2 pool if you control the biggest assamite is good, as is a copy or two of khabar glory. Is you want a solid deck with contract subtheme, use dem assamites, or g2 with dom for bleeds and deflections.
But regardless, streamline, nad use sideslips. As of now, burst of sunlight drops you.

Quick question, does open dossier allow you to block without the assistance of an untap type card (on the qui vie). I'd post the full text buy don't have it to hand.

Yes.
Open Dossier
Reaction
1 blood
Only usable by a vampire who has been chosen for a contract on the acting minion. This vampire attempts to block with +2 intercept and gets an optional maneuver in the resulting combat if successful. Usable by a tapped vampire even if intercept is not yet needed.
